TL;DR Summary

Police in Senegal's capital, Dakar, fired tear gas at stone-throwing protesters ahead of a court case involving opposition politician Ousmane Sonko, who faces trial for libel and rape charges. Sonko denies all wrongdoing and says the accusations are politically motivated to prevent him from running in the February 2024 polls. Protests have taken place for three days ahead of Sonko's court appearance, with supporters accusing President Macky Sall of seeking to eliminate him from the competition with a guilty verdict.
